On Saturday, February 9th, Founder Krystal Persaud competed in Talk Trash Cityās 4th annual competition and won the $5,000 prize!
Talk Trash City is a series of fun, energetic conversations intended to critique fresh ideas about handling waste. Their aim is to create a vibrant and useful dialogue between industry experts and innovators so that ambitious goals can become real, sustainable progress. They host an annual competition where 4 eco-minded entrepreneurs compete for prize money to grow their business.
Other competing organizations included:
-
Make It BlackĀ is a luxury dye and re-design service, using color theory to solve the environmental and economic crises of the fashion industry.
-
PliaĀ is the first closed loop, zero waste furniture company offering contemporary designed furniture that allows consumers to keep materials out of the waste stream.
-
Pulpmadeās āPosse Chairā is sustainable childrenās furniture that sparks imagination and creativity - made from recycled paper and cardboard, paper pulp is non-toxic, lightweight, and softāa great match for children.
